Holographic Sound-and-Light Installation by TUNDRA
The ROW installation, interacting with space, interprets the possibility of visualizing these signals using LED fans installed in a row, which rotate to create a holographic effect of structures floating in the air, and which are controlled by generative algorithms.

The modern urban environment is permeated with electromagnetic waves that are imperceptible to the human eye. Rows of data floating in the air, transforming into symbols, words, and sentences, which, in turn, try to translate our speech, our thoughts, and feelings.

SPACE
Light-proofed and preferably sound-proofed, blacked-out space.

The Installation is meant for INDOOR locations, so outdoor placement must be confirmed with our team.

Row is a scalable installation with possible various lengths, however it is pre-ferable to consider a dedicated and isolated space with possibility of black-out. LIGHT BLOCK panel/door or preferably heavy curtains should be placed in the entrance and exit zones to avoid external light and sound pollution.

1.5m each side for safety barriers, 65cm in between stands. Standard edition of 10 led fans is a rectangle 7.5m x 3m. The cables go to FOH which can be located in a separate room

Tundra is a collective of new media artists exploring the facets of human perception of new sound and visual images in the context of spatial dialogue.

TUNDRA's artistic practices include a/v performances, sound&light installations, generative art, multimedia avant-garde experimentations, and NFTs. In the conceptual core behind the works, there is an idea of searching for a balance between chaos and order that is represented through the mixing of technology and nature and expressing the inexpressible through new forms of art.

The artworks have been exhibited at museums, galleries and festivals of multi-media art in America, Great Britain, Europe, Australia, and Asia.
